Understanding Non-Lethal Self-Protection Devices

Non-lethal self-protection devices are designed to incapacitate or deter an attacker without causing permanent harm, making them popular choices for personal safety. These tools are often used as alternatives to firearms and offer a range of options, from stun guns to pepper spray. One key aspect when considering non-lethal protection is understanding their effectiveness against various situations. For instance, do stun guns work through clothing? The answer varies; some models can deliver a powerful shock even with clothing intervening, while others may require direct contact. This distinction is crucial as it determines the device’s practicality in different scenarios.

Knowing the specifications and features of these devices, such as range, power output, and activation methods, is essential for informed decision-making. Users should consider the environment and potential threats when choosing a non-lethal option. For example, in close-quarters situations where direct contact may be difficult, stun guns with longer ranges or those capable of penetrating clothing could prove more effective. Conversely, pepper spray might be more suitable for open areas, offering a wide area of protection.

The Effectiveness of Stun Guns Through Clothing

Stun guns, often hailed as non-lethal self-defense tools, have sparked interest for their ability to incapacitate assailants. However, a common question arises: do they truly work through clothing? The answer lies in understanding the technology and its limitations. Stun guns emit an electric charge designed to disrupt muscle control, causing the target to experience temporary paralysis. This effect is achieved by delivering a strong electrical current that can penetrate certain materials, but not all fabrics are equally conductive.

Clothing, especially thick or insulated garments, can act as a barrier, reducing the stun gun’s effectiveness. While some high-quality stun guns claim to penetrate most types of clothing, practical testing suggests otherwise. The success rate largely depends on factors such as the type of fabric, its thickness, and the specific design of the weapon. Therefore, users must be aware that the reliability of a stun gun in real-world scenarios may vary, especially when facing well-clothed assailants.

Key Specifications to Consider for Non-Lethal Self-Defense Tools

When considering non-lethal self-defense tools, several key specifications stand out as essential for effectiveness and safety. Firstly, look for devices with a proven track record in incapacitating attackers without causing permanent harm. Stun guns, also known as electroshock weapons, are popular choices but their effectiveness can vary; ensure the device delivers a strong enough electrical shock to disrupt an attacker’s muscular control, even through clothing.

Other crucial factors include ease of use, with simple and intuitive activation mechanisms, and compact design for easy portability. Weight is also important; lighter devices are more comfortable to carry and reduce fatigue during emergency situations. Additionally, consider tools with adjustable output settings to adapt to different scenarios and target sizes, ensuring the device remains effective while minimizing unnecessary pain or harm to bystanders.
